Underground Drilling Supervisor - Percussive Posted Thursday, August 6, 2026 at 1:00 AM Established in 1890, Boart Longyear is the world’s leading provider of drilling services, orebody knowledge technology, and innovative, safe, and productivity-driven drilling equipment. With its main focus in mining and exploration activities spanning a wide range of commodities, including copper, gold, nickel, zinc, uranium, and other metals and minerals, the Company holds a substantial presence in the energy, oil sands exploration, and environmental sectors.
The Global Drilling
Services division operates for a diverse mining customer base with drilling methods including diamond coring exploration, reverse circulation, large diameter rotary, mine dewatering, water supply drilling, pump services, production, and sonic drilling services.

Hourly Wage: $54.43/hr plus up to $40/hr bonus. This posting is for our various sites across Ontario including Timmins & Red Lake. Address any performance or conduct issues as they arise in a timely and respectful manner.
Co-ordinate and allocatework as required to meet drilling plans in the most cost effective/efficient way while meeting safety compliance requirements, including theco-ordination of relief team members as required. Complete and approve daily reports to send to contracts administrators for payroll and clientinvoicing requirements. Provide technical advice tostaff to effectively manage drilling operations.
Liaise with the Project Manager and/or Field Supervisorregarding the progress of the drilling program. Demonstrate safety leadership and assist team members with thedevelopment of thorough risk assessments and job safetyanalysis. Report all safety hazardsor workplace injury/illness to the client and management immediately.
Lead investigations of allincidents / hazard management issues that occur in the work area and on shift andensure effective corrective actions are identified, implemented and monitoredin a timely and productive manner.
